Impact of web and digital experience on the stickiness of third party hotel website / Nina Farisha Isa...[et al]
The rapid development and use of mobile technologies has changed the way of our everyday lives, especially individual that feel a sense of experience as a tool for enhancing task performance. In addition, mobile technologies also have changed the way marketers and consumers communicate. However, dig...
